WebThe Illinois Probate Act categorizes all claims against the deceased’s estate into seven classes: Funeral and burial expenses. The surviving spouse’s or child’s award. Debts due to the United States. Reasonable and necessary medical, hospital, and nursing home expenses. Money and property received or held in trust by the decedent. WebJul 13, 2010 · In this case, filing a timely claim against the estate once the PR is appointed is the best and most effective means for a creditor to protect its rights. N.C.G.S. § 28A-14-1(a) requires the PR to publish notice to all persons, firms or corporations having claims against the decedent. This notice is made through a newspaper circulated in the ...
